I justed wanted to say thank you to everyone who gave me advice regarding my ball python.

Just to recap my python was having a bad shed and his head and eye caps wouldn't shed. Well I did get the shed off his head with much soaking and misting. But then he still wouldn't eat. Well about 4 days ago his eyes went cloudy so I started to mist the enclosure to bring up the humidity. Which was a tip you gave me as well as the heating sources I was using. I watched the humidity gauge and it was up. Then last night I noticed him starting to shed under his chin and within 2 hours he had completely shed his whole skin and he looks great. I imagine tonight I will have to get a mouse for him. He hasn't eatin in about 4 weeks.

I do have a question though. Will one small mouse be enough since he hadn't eatin in 4 weeks or should I just waite to see how he does with one mouse?
